FLEXIBILITY AND NATURAL COMFORT


Blending the injury-prevention qualities of barefoot running with the comfort and durability of a moccasin shoe, the Nike N7 Free Forward Moc+ Men's Shoe wraps your foot with a skin-like feel and lightweight support.


Benefits

  • Breathable mesh upper with multi-layer construction for a lightweight fit
  • Off-center lacing and full inner sleeve for plush comfort
  • Phylite midsole/outsole for lightweight support and cushioning
  • Deep Nike Free sipes enhance flexibility for a barefoot-like ride
  • Rubber outsole with waffle pistons enhance cushioning and response
  • Weight: 9.5 ounces (based on men's size 10)

About Nike N7

Since 2009, Nike's N7 program has provided more than $2 million of support to Native American and Aboriginal youth sports programs, helping them experience teamwork and leadership. The program is driven by Native American wisdom of the Seven Generations: In every deliberation, we must consider the impact of our decisions on the seventh generation. The ultimate goal of Nike N7 is to consider this impact and to help Native American and Aboriginal youth recognize their proud history and build on it for a triumphant future.


Nike Free Origins

After learning that Stanford athletes had been training barefoot on the university's golf course, three of Nike's most innovative and creative employees set out to develop a shoe that felt natural and weightless, similar to bare feet. In 2002, they examined a group of men and women with pressure-measuring insoles taped to their feet, using high-speed cameras to capture images of each foot in motion.


The team spent eight years studying the biomechanics of shoeless running. The results yielded a profound understanding of the foot's natural landing angle, pressure and toe position, allowing Nike designers to build an unconventional and flexible running shoe from the inside out.
